在现代互联网时代,网站设计已经不仅仅是美观的问题,更涉及技术、用户体验及SEO等多个方面的综合考量。随着技术的发展,网站设计的技术路线也愈发成熟,涵盖了多个层面,下面我们将详细探讨这一主题。
1. 网站设计的基本框架
网站设计的技术路线可分为几个主要组成部分:前端开发、后端开发、用户体验设计(UX)和搜索引擎优化(SEO)。这些部分既相互独立又紧密关联,为用户提供流畅的体验和有效的信息交流。
1.1 前端开发
前端开发是指用户直接看到和操作的部分,通常涉及以下几种技术:
- HTML(超文本标记语言):用于创建网页的基础结构。
- CSS(层叠样式表):用于设计网页的外观和布局。
- JavaScript:用于实现网页的交互功能。
前端开发需要保证网站在各种终端(PC、手机、平板等)上的良好显示,因此响应式设计技术变得尤为重要。借助媒体查询和灵活的布局,可以让网页在不同屏幕尺寸下保持优秀的可用性。
1.2 后端开发
后端开发处理的是用户看不见的部分,主要是网站的逻辑和数据库管理。后端的常用技术包括:
- 服务器端语言:如PHP、Python、Ruby、Java等。
- 数据库管理系统:如MySQL、PostgreSQL、MongoDB等。
- 应用程序接口(API):提供前端与后端之间的数据交互。
后端设计要确保数据的安全性和处理效率。采用RESTful API或GraphQL等技术可以提高数据交互的灵活性和效率。
2. 用户体验设计(UX)
用户体验设计在网站设计中扮演着重要角色,旨在提高用户与网站交互的满意度。一个好的用户体验设计不仅仅是美观,更注重功能的完备和逻辑的清晰。
- 信息架构:网站的结构需要合理,确保用户能方便地找到所需信息。
- 用户界面设计(UI): 视觉设计,应考虑颜色、字体、图像和按钮等元素的和谐搭配。
- 可用性测试:通过测试和反馈,不断优化设计,提升用户满意度。
2.1 调研和用户反馈
调研用户需求是设计过程的起点,通过问卷调查、用户访谈等方式,了解目标用户的偏好和痛点,可以大大提升设计的针对性和有效性。此外,A/B测试也是一个不错的选择,可以通过对比不同版本的表现来找到最佳设计方案。
3. 搜索引擎优化(SEO)
网站设计的技术路线中,SEO是不可忽视的一部分。即使网站设计再好,如果无法在搜索引擎中获得良好的排名,用户也可能无法找到网站。
3.1 关键词研究
进行关键词研究,找出用户在搜索引擎中常用的搜索词。使用工具如Google Keyword Planner或Ahrefs,可以帮助设计团队选择合适的关键词。关键词应自然地融入到网站的标题、描述、内容和图片的alt属性中。
3.2 网站性能优化
网站性能直接影响用户体验和SEO排名。通过压缩图片、使用CDN、优化HTML/CSS/JavaScript代码等方式,可以提高网站加载速度。通常,网站加载时间应控制在3秒以内,以减少用户流失。
3.3 移动端优化
随着移动互联网的普及,确保网站在手机上的友好体验至关重要。移动优先设计及AMP(加速移动页面)等技术,有助于提升移动设备用户的访问体验。
4. 整体设计流程
以上所有元素并非孤立存在,而是需要通过一个完整的设计流程有机结合。设计流程通常包括:
- 需求分析:与客户沟通,了解需求和目标。
- 架构设计:绘制网站框架图,设计信息架构。
- 原型设计:构建低保真和高保真的原型,以便于测试和反馈。
- 视觉设计:根据原型进行视觉元素的设计,确保品牌形象一致。
- 开发和测试:前后端开发完成后,进行全面测试,确保各项功能正常。
- 上线和维护:将网站上线并定期维护,根据用户反馈进行优化。
时间、预算与团队协作
合理的时间管理和预算规划是成功网站设计的关键。此外,项目的多方协调,包括设计师、开发人员和SEO专家之间的沟通和协作,能确保各个环节无缝对接,避免不必要的返工。
通过以上的分析,我们可以看到网站设计的技术路线是一项系统工程,需要多方面的技术支持和团队协作。无论是前端还是后端,从用户体验到搜索引擎优化,每一个细节都能影响最终的效果。在这个竞争激烈的数字时代,掌握这些技术路线,将有助于打造出更具吸引力和竞争力的网站。